深入理解Web3网络费用的收取机制及其影响

引言:Web3时代的来临

随着互联网的发展,我们已经进入了一个全新的时代——Web3。相比于Web2,Web3不仅仅是技术的升级,更是人类思维方式的转变。在这个新生态中,区块链、去中心化、智能合约等概念逐渐深入人心。而在使用这些技术构建网络的时候,网络费用的收取成为了一个不可忽视的话题。

什么是Web3网络费用?

深入理解Web3网络费用的收取机制及其影响

Web3网络费用,是指用户在使用基于区块链的应用程序时,需要支付给网络节点或者矿工的一种费用。这一费用用于补偿节点或矿工在验证和记录交易过程中所付出的计算资源和时间。在不同的区块链网络中,费用的结构和收取的方式可能有所不同。

Web3网络费用的组成

了解网络费用的具体组成,能够帮助用户更好地掌握成本控制。通常情况下,Web3网络费用主要由以下几部分组成:

  • 交易费用(Transaction Fees):每一笔交易都需要支付一定的费用,这个费用通常是以加密货币的形式支付的。在以太坊网络上,交易费用被称为“Gas费用”,就是为了补偿矿工对交易进行验证和录入的工作。
  • 智能合约执行费用(Contract Execution Fees):当用户调用智能合约时,也需要支付相应的费用。这与交易费用类似,但通常因执行复杂度而异。
  • 网络拥堵费用(Network Congestion Fees):在网络拥堵的情况下,用户常常需要支付更高的费用,以优先处理其交易。这种现象在以太坊等网络中尤为明显。

Web3网络费用的收取方式

深入理解Web3网络费用的收取机制及其影响

不同的区块链网络,关于网络费用的收取方式又各有不同。以太坊、比特币以及其他一些公链的区别,为我们提供了许多引人深思的案例。

以太坊:Gas费用机制

以太坊作为一个流行的智能合约平台,其费用机制以“Gas”作为核心。用户在发起交易时,需要设定愿意支付的Gas Price(单位时间内能处理的交易量),以及交易的Gas Limit(每笔交易能消耗的最大Gas)。这种机制使得交易的速度和费用呈现出一定的弹性,用户可以根据自己的需求进行调整。

比特币:矿工费用

相比之下,比特币的费用模式较为简洁。用户在发起交易时,支付给矿工的费用通常依赖于网络的实时竞争情况。矿工会根据每笔交易的提供的费用高低来决定处理的优先级。由于比特币网络的区块大小和确认时间限制,交易费用在高峰期可能会大幅上升。

其他公链的探索

除了以太坊和比特币,许多其他公链也开始尝试不同的费用模式。例如,Solana网络以极低的费用和快速的确认时间吸引了大量用户,其费用策略为用户提供了极佳的体验。

Web3网络费用的影响因素

在理解Web3网络费用的机制时,让我们关注几个关键影响因素,它们直接决定了费用的高低和用户体验的优劣。

  • 网络规模和拥堵情况: 网络的用户越多,交易越频繁,费用自然会上升。在网络拥堵的情况下,用户需提供更高的费用才能增加其交易被优先处理的几率。
  • 交易复杂性: 执行更复杂的交易或智能合约,通常需要支付更高的费用。这是因为计算利息、调用多个合约、状态更改等操作都加大了对资源的需求。
  • 市场供需: 市场上对网络资源的需求和供给状况是费用波动的主要原因。在需求高峰期,网络费用往往会迅速飙升。

控制Web3网络费用的小技巧

为了有效控制在Web3上的网络费用,用户可以采取一些策略:

  • 选择合适的时间进行交易: 观察网络高峰期和低谷期,尽量选择在费用相对低廉的时候发起交易,可以避免不必要的支出。
  • 合理设置Gas Price: 根据当前的网络状况,合理设置Gas Price,使得您的交易既能顺利完成又不会支付过高的费用。
  • 使用二层解决方案: 部分链上网络提供了二层解决方案,可以显著减少费用。用户可以通过这些解决方案进行交易,享受更低的费用和更快的确认速度。

未来展望:Web3的费用机制发展

随着Web3技术的不断发展,费用机制也将呈现出新趋势。一方面,随着以太坊2.0及其他更新版本的推出,网络效率将大幅提升,从根本上降低用户的费用支出;另一方面,新的去中心化金融(DeFi)应用出现,可能会引入更多创新的费用机制。

清晰透明的费用结构

未来Web3的费用结构可能会变得更加透明,用户在执行交易或智能合约时,不仅可以清楚地看到将要支付的费用,还能预判交易的成本。这种透明性将进一步增强用户的信任感,激发他们对Web3的积极参与。

智能合约中的费用

智能合约的发展也将引领费用的进一步。例如,智能合约中可以嵌入动态费用设置,分析用户的历史交易数据,自动为用户选择最低的费用。这样的创新将使得交易更加经济实惠。

总结

在Web3的世界里,了解网络费用的结构和收取机制是每一个用户必备的知识。在运行机制的复杂中,费用显得尤为重要。它不仅关系到用户的资金支出,同时也影响着整个网络的运行效率和活力。未来,随着技术的进步,Web3将为我们提供更加灵活和友好的费用体验。随着区块链技术的不断演化,费用的透明性和可控性将成为用户参与这一生态的关键因素。